Okay, I know there are quite a few other threads out there that are similar. I have looked at them all and found no solution to my problem, except to reinstall the operating system. Since I am at a university on a university owned computer, they don't give me the os, so that isn't an option.
My 40gb 4th gen ipod connects fine in the finder, but itunes doesn't recognize it. The iPod Updater also doesn't recognize the ipod. I have tried searching for "itunes" and deleting everything but the library, then reinstalling iTunes 4.6. It worked one time, then never again. I also tried the same thing for "ipod," same results. I tried logging in under another user; still doesn't mount in itunes. I hooked it up to another computer, same os, same everything else, and it worked! So it isn't my cable. I also read that it could be my FW connections on the cpu. I would assume my other FW devices that I am piggybacking with wouldn't work either if that was the problem.
